sql >> Database >  >> NoSQL >> Redis

Start redis-server met configuratiebestand

Oké, redis is behoorlijk gebruiksvriendelijk, maar er zijn enkele problemen.

Hier zijn slechts enkele eenvoudige commando's voor het werken met redis op Ubuntu:

installeren:

sudo apt-get install redis-server

begin met conf:

sudo redis-server <path to conf>
sudo redis-server config/redis.conf

stop met conf:

redis-ctl shutdown

(weet niet zeker hoe dit de pid afsluit die is gespecificeerd in de conf. Redis moet het pad naar de pid ergens tijdens het opstarten opslaan)

log:

tail -f /var/log/redis/redis-server.log

Ook waren verschillende voorbeeldconfs die online en op deze site rondzweven meer dan nutteloos. De beste, zekere manier om een ​​compatibele conf te krijgen, is door degene die je installatie al gebruikt te kopiëren en plakken. Je zou het hier moeten kunnen vinden:

/etc/redis/redis.conf

Plak het dan op <path to conf> , pas aan waar nodig en je bent klaar om te gaan.



  1. hoe toegang te krijgen tot socketsessie in alle clusters

  2. Verbinding geweigerd voor Redis op Heroku

  3. Is er een vergrendelingsmechanisme in Azure Redis Cache tijdens het bijwerken van een item?

  4. Hoe een mongodb-verbinding opnieuw te gebruiken via Promise